logo

Output 63caf59c8876c7292c41824a948e19edac95f8662597cbc1025f72737fd4478e:0

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2289c5efd4aac2f49b21a5691548f2845f4d76 OP_EQUAL
address
37AyqoptK4KWBNcbENYmrv41KWGbecQhX2
transaction
63caf59c8876c7292c41824a948e19edac95f8662597cbc1025f72737fd4478e